The Board's approval is subject to the following criteria also: The Board noted the protected bike lanes on Main Street are approximately 7' wide. The standard for minimum bike lane width is 5'. With this in mind, the Board can allow the sidewalk cafe to use up most of the sidewalk space but keep 2 feet clear from the outdoor fence and the brick band as shown in the attached diagram. The Board noted this will count the 1' of the brick band as well as 1' from the protected bike lane as part of the ADA clearance (which is a minimum of 4'). Additionally, the Board will require installing a sign on the north end of the sidewalk cafe fence warning pedestrians, bicyclists and wheelchairs of the "shared zone" they are entering. Attached is the sign design that the Board ask the businesses to print and install on their caf6 fence. This permit is for the set-up of the caf6 only; the regulations for the serving of food and alcohol are outside the Board's authority and will need to be followed. Following is the applicable rule: Chapter 3 CHAPTER R3: TECHNICAL PROVISIONS R301 Pedestrian Access Route R301.1 General. Pedestrian access routes shall comply with R301 and shall connect pedestrian elements and facilities required to be accessible. R301.2 Components. Pedestrian access routes shall consist of one or more of the following components: walkways, ramps, curb ramps (excluding flared sides) and landings, blended transitions, crosswalks, and pedestrian overpasses and underpasses, elevators, and platform lifts. Stairways and escalators shall not be part of a pedestrian access route. All components of a pedestrian access route shall comply with the applicable portions of this document. R301.3 Width R301.3.1 Continuous width. The minimum continuous and unobstructed clear width of a pedestrian access route shall be 1.2 m (4.0 ft), exclusive of the width of the curb. Advisory R301.3.1 Continuous Width. The pedestrian access route provides a minimum accessible route of passage within a sidewalk or other walkway that may not comprise the full width of the pedestrian circulation route, particularly in urban areas. Industry -recommended sidewalk widths can be found in 'Guide for the Planning, Design, and Operation of Pedestrian Facilities', American Association of State Highway and Transportation Officials, July 2004 (www.aashto.org). The minimum width must be maintained without obstruction. Where a pedestrian access route turns or changes direction, it should accommodate the continuous passage of a wheelchair or scooter. As with street or highway design for vehicles, additional maneuvering width or length may be needed at recesses and alcoves, doorways and entrances, and along curved or angled routings, particularly where the grade exceeds 5%. Individual segments of pedestrian access routes should have a minimum straight length of 1.2 m (4.0 ft). Street furniture, including fixed or movable elements such as newspaper and sales racks, cafe seating and tables, bus shelters, vender carts, sidewalk sculptures, and bicycle racks, shall not reduce the required width of the pedestrian access route. Provisions for protruding objects apply across the entire width of the pedestrian circulation path, not just the pedestrian access route.
